The IELTS exam examines four core English language skills: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The test is divided into 2 types: Academic and General Training, dealing with various purposes.
IELTS Test TypePurposeAcademicFor admission to higher education institutionsGeneral TrainingFor immigration or vocational purposes
Each section is graded on a band scale from 0 to 9, with a rating of 6 to 7 normally thought about appropriate for academic options.

Frequently Asked QuestionsQ1: How challenging is the IELTS exam?
The problem level differs by individual. Prospects who have a good grasp of English and practice frequently may discover it manageable.
Q2: Is self-study enough to pass the IELTS?
Yes, self-study can be sufficient if prospects are disciplined and make use of reliable resources. Nevertheless, individual inspirations and commitment play a significant function.
Q3: What is the minimum IELTS rating needed for universities?
Most universities require a minimum rating of 6.0 to 7.0; nevertheless, this varies by organization.
Q4: How long should I prepare for the IELTS?
Preparation time differs considerably with individual efficiency levels. A normal range is 4-12 weeks of devoted practice.
Q5: Can I retake the IELTS exam?
Yes, candidates can retake the IELTS exam as many times as they want to attain their wanted score.
